Marie‐Aude Piot is a scholar working on Clinical Psychology, Psychiatry and Mental health and General Health Professions. According to data from OpenAlex, Marie‐Aude Piot has authored 42 papers receiving a total of 253 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 18 papers in Clinical Psychology, 12 papers in Psychiatry and Mental health and 11 papers in General Health Professions. Recurrent topics in Marie‐Aude Piot's work include Innovations in Medical Education (10 papers), Psychoanalysis and Psychopathology Research (9 papers) and Simulation-Based Education in Healthcare (8 papers). Marie‐Aude Piot is often cited by papers focused on Innovations in Medical Education (10 papers), Psychoanalysis and Psychopathology Research (9 papers) and Simulation-Based Education in Healthcare (8 papers). Marie‐Aude Piot collaborates with scholars based in France, United Kingdom and Netherlands. Marie‐Aude Piot's co-authors include Bruno Falissard, Chris Attoe, Antoine Tesnière, D. Michelet, Fabrice Jollant, Sean Cross, Jan‐Joost Rethans, Cédric Lemogne, Agnès Dechartres and Gilles Guerrier and has published in prestigious journals such as PLoS ONE, Journal of Advanced Nursing and Medical Education.
